Guiding Image-to-3D Generation with Test-Time Partial Observations
Papers76
While single-image 3D generative models produce visually appealing assets, their underlying geometry is often under-constrained. This paper presents a training-free test-time guidance framework that injects partial geometric observations directly into pretrained generators. By formulating a ray-consistent observation likelihood over the model's occupancy field—accounting for both surface presence and free-space evidence—the method substantially improves geometric fidelity on models like SAM 3D without parameter updates.
